I have a 94 grand cherokee 3" spacers amd shocks only. I used to have death wobble with stock tires when i would hit a bump doing about 50mph, found out the stearing stabilizer was missing. I poped one on and all was good. Now i bought set of 36/13.50r15 irok super swampers, with 2" spacers to make fit. Now i get death wobble on smooth payment going about 40. I check all my bushings, and made sure everything is tight. What do i do next to get it to stop cheap fixes first, because i will one day put bigger axels and all under my jeep. So i dont want to spend alot of money to just get rid of later. Just please any suggestions im a mechanic and cut weld and fabercate anything so no idea to far out there.

I had dw in both my xjs first one was caused by worn tie rod ends sec one was cause of loose track bar.. but bad uca an lca bushings will give you the loose feeling just before dw hits. Definitely make sure you have track bar brackets or adjustable track bars. Also check your ball joints, replace your steering stabilizer if it's stock and looks bad. Also check your hub assemblies, control arm bushings, etc.
